Overview:
A mount that enables users to take 3D stereographic photos with a smartphone. See included example photo.
Background:
Stereographs are a set of two similar pictures taken at slightly differing positions to provide "parallax," the perspective difference between the two photos. This parallax, when viewed through the correct viewers, makes the brain think it is seeing an image in 3D! Usually, these photos are taken 65 mm apart, to simulate the average interpupillary distance (the distance between the eyes). Stereographs first became common around the American Civil War, and many early stereoscopic pictures can be found from that era.
Printing Notes:
Both the "Carriage Rail" and the "Phone Carriage" parts are needed. The carriage rail comes in two flavors: A 6mm hole to directly mount to a tripod (unrecommended) and a square area made to fit a 1/4x20 square nut.
